We'll Follow Thee

Author: Grace Glenn Appears in 8 hymnals Matching Instances: 3 First Line: Step by step, and day by day Refrain First Line: Savior, Master, teach us Lyrics: 1 Step by step and day by day, March we on our forward way; Never backward, never still, Guided by our leader’s will. Refrain: Savior, Master, teach us where All thy perfect pathways are; Weak and humble tho’ we be, Step by step we’ll follow thee. 2 Step by step and one by one, Lives begin and lives are done; True and firm for Jesus’ sake, Let us make each step we take. [Refrain] 3 Step by step, the task is small, None too great for each and all; Just by this and nothing more, Shall we reach the heav’nly shore. [Refrain] Topics: Children's Songs; Work Used With Tune: [Step by step, and day by day]

Truest Friend, who canst not fail

Author: Miss Winkworth; John Neunherz Appears in 3 hymnals Matching Instances: 1 Lyrics: 1 Truest Friend, who canst not fail, Evermore abide with me: When the world would most assail, Then Thy presence let me see. When its heaviest thunders roll, Shelter Thou my trembling soul! Come, and in my spirit rest; Help me do what seems Thee best. 2 When life's day hath fleeted by, When the night of death is near, When in vain the darkened eye Seeks some stay, some helper here: Then Thy followers' prayer fulfil, Then abide Thou with us still: Till Thou give us heavenly rest, Stay, O stay, Thou noble Guest! Topics: The Christian Life Trust in Christ and Redemption; Sundays in Lent; Twenty Fifth Sunday after Trinity Used With Tune: REFUGE

Lord, take Thou the veil away

Author: Freiderich Gottlieb Klopstock; Jane Borthwick Appears in 2 hymnals Matching Instances: 1 Lyrics: 1 Lord, take Thou the veil away, Let us see Thyself today! Thou who calmest from on high, For our sins to bleed and die, Help us now to cast aside All that would our hearts divide; With the Father and the Son Let thy living Church be one. Amen. 2 O, from earthly cares set free, Let us find our rest in Thee! May our cares and conflicts cease In the calm of Sabbath peace, That Thy people here below Something of the bliss may know, Something of the rest and love In the Sabbath home above! 3 Lord, Thy sinful child prepare For a place and portion there! Give my soul the spotless dress Of Thy perfect Righteousness: Than at length, a welcome guest, I shall enter to the feast, Earthly cares and sorrows o'er, Joys to last for evermore. Topics: The Church Year Opening of Service; Twelfth Sunday after Trinity Used With Tune: REFUGE, NO. 2
